Delta South APC Leaders, Stakeholders to Converge in Oleh as Senator Joel-Onowakpo Announces Second-Term Bid
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on WhatsappSend to Email

Leaders and stakeholders of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Delta South Senatorial District are set to converge in Oleh for the official declaration of the lawmaker representing the district in the National Assembly, Joel-Onowakpo Thomas, as he signals his intention for a second term.

The announcement was contained in a formal notice issued on behalf of the senator, inviting key party executives and stakeholders across the eight local government areas of Delta South to witness the declaration, an event expected to attract significant political attention within the state.

According to the notice signed by Emma Amgbaduba, the declaration will take place on Friday, May 1, 2026, at Oleh Township Stadium in Oleh, Isoko South Local Government Area of Delta State, with proceedings scheduled to commence at 11:00 a.m.

The invitation specifically calls on all State Working Committee members of the APC from Delta South, State Executive Committee members, Local Government Area chairmen and their executive teams, as well as ward chairmen and their executives across the district to attend the event.

Party insiders say the declaration forms part of ongoing political activities ahead of the 2027 general elections, as key actors within the APC intensify consultations and grassroots mobilization.

The notice emphasized the importance of unity and collective commitment among party faithful, urging invitees to participate actively in what it described as a crucial gathering for the progress and electoral success of the APC in Delta South.

“This important gathering is an opportunity for members of our great party to come together in unity and solidarity as we work towards sustained victory and development in Delta South,” the statement noted.

The declaration is also expected to reinforce the party’s “Renewed Hope for M.O.R.E. Agenda,” a slogan aligning national APC objectives with local development aspirations in Delta State.

The event is expected to serve as a rallying point for party cohesion in the district, while also setting the tone for campaign strategies and alliances ahead of the next electoral cycle.
